While it is common to see people searching for "Tamil aunty phone numbers" or "WhatsApp numbers" online, it is crucial to understand the risks, the reality behind these advertisements, and how to protect your privacy and security in digital spaces. The Reality of "Contact Number" Lists

Most websites or social media pages claiming to provide a "Tamil aunty WhatsApp number" list are not what they seem. These platforms typically fall into three categories:

Scams and Phishing: Many of these sites are designed to steal your personal information. Clicking on suspicious links can lead to malware infections on your phone or computer.

Clickbait and Ad Revenue: Creators often use sensational titles to drive traffic to their blogs or YouTube channels. The "numbers" provided are often fake, disconnected, or belong to unsuspecting people who are being harassed.

Privacy Violations: Using or sharing someone’s private contact information without their consent is a serious violation of privacy and, in many jurisdictions, is illegal. Risks of Engaging with Such Sites

Financial Fraud: Scammers often pose as someone else to build trust and eventually ask for money for "emergencies" or "travel expenses."

Identity Theft: Providing your own number or details on these forums can lead to your data being sold to telemarketers or hackers.

Legal Consequences: Harassing individuals through numbers found on the internet can lead to legal action under cyber-harassment laws. Safe Ways to Connect Online

Childhood and Adolescence

A girl’s upbringing differs vastly by region. In South India, the Half-Saree function marks a girl’s transition to womanhood. In North India, the Mundan (head shaving) ceremony for young children is common. However, for decades, the most controversial rite was the lack of formal education for girls, a trend that has thankfully reversed. Today, the Ritu Kala (menarche ceremony) in Tamil Nadu or Shanti Puja in Bengal celebrates a girl’s fertility, though modern feminists argue this ritual sexualizes girls too early.

The past 20 years have witnessed a seismic shift. With the liberalization of the Indian economy in the 1990s, women entered the workforce en masse—not just as teachers, but as pilots, police officers, and CEOs.

The New Metro Woman: She lives in Mumbai, Delhi, or Hyderabad. She rents a flat with friends, uses Zomato for food, and Uber for safety. Her lifestyle is defined by: South Indian women are known for their elegant

The Dual Burden: However, liberation is incomplete. Studies show that even when Indian women earn money, they spend 3x more hours on domestic chores than men. The "Second Shift" (working at the office, then working at home) is a reality.
